Pressure Groups, Policies and Development, EEC and the Third World

JP Verloren van Themaat, C Stevens

Research output: Book/Report/Inaugural speech/Farewell speechBookAcademic

Abstract

The effects of the activities of various political and non-political pressure groups (NGOs, business, trade-unions) on the policies of the EEC toward the Third World are analysed from an economic and political perspective, as well as the effects of such policy pressures, including an analysis of the Third Lome Convention, the most recent Multi Fibre Arrangement and the effects of the Common Agricultural Policy.
